Summary
Early detection of atrial fibrillation (AF) is essential for preventing ischemic stroke and other cardiovascular complications. However, the incidence and prognosis of AF in the general middle-aged population remain unclear. In Japan, annual health screenings for employees include mandatory ECGs, offering a unique opportunity to fill this evidence gap. This retrospective cohort study aimed to evaluate the incidence and subsequent cardiovascular outcomes of screening-detected AF in the general working population in Japan, using the Japan Health Insurance Association database, which covers one-quarter of the working-age population of that country. From individuals 35 to 59 years of age who underwent annual health screenings between April 2015 and March 2020, excluding those with a history of cardiovascular disease, those with initial AF detection upon screening ECGs were identified. The primary outcome was hospitalization for ischemic stroke. The secondary outcomes were all-cause death and hospitalization for heart failure. The association between screening-detected AF and outcomes was evaluated using adjusted subdistribution hazard models compared with matched controls.
Findings: Among 9.5 million individuals included in our study, 11,790 initial AF cases were detected. Individuals with AF were older and more likely to be male compared with non-AF cases (91.6% versus 63.6%, respectively). Among these individuals with screening-detected AF, the 3-year incidences of ischemic stroke, all-cause death, and heart failure were 1.83% , 0.78%, and 3.87%, respectively. Compared with age- and sex-matched controls, individuals with AF had a higher risk of incident ischemic stroke, all-cause death, and heart failure.
These findings highlight the association of screening-detected AF with stroke and heart failure, warranting further study into AF as an early sign of heart failure and optimal cardiovascular risk reduction strategies after AF detection in the general middle-aged population.
